Output d9374778b0da55cdd0a00bb07556b60e8c89884dfa9e9ca4127d44ee3c9c122e:6

value
23342626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8623672170e48ed9d4a21cf5f648eb1d5290787 OP_EQUAL
address
MSAh2jTPBEUxk9f4kHMcaNBETn7AGhM82Z
transaction
d9374778b0da55cdd0a00bb07556b60e8c89884dfa9e9ca4127d44ee3c9c122e
spent
true